As the sun softens, life returns to the streets. Chai-wallahs become social hubs. Children play cricket in narrow lanes using a plastic pipe as a bat. This is the hour of aarti —the ritual of light—at temples and homes. It is also the hour for adda (intellectual banter) in Bengal or tamasha (theatrical gossip) in Maharashtra. The line between the sacred and the social is deliberately blurred.
